Chinese women showing true grit

By Sun Xiaochen | China Daily | Updated: 2018-07-10 07:14

Title-winning performances by Chinese women are making a strong statement on the rise of female fighters in a sport that places overwhelming emphasis on masculinity.

Using fast combinations of jabs and hooks to confidently dictate the pace, "Killer Bee" Chuang Kai-ting danced to a five-round unanimous decision over Muay Thai specialist Yodcherry Sityodtong on Saturday to win the inaugural One Super Series kickboxing world atomweight title at Guangzhou's Tianhe Gymnasium.

The 23-year-old channeled Muhammad Ali's fabled footwork en route to sending a strong message to the swelling female fanbase for the combat sport in Asia.
